Transaction 723e40bb9d5f366ee195873c8b8250c956fd2bae582dacb883368dd02944e975

1 Input
2 Outputs
  • 723e40bb9d5f366ee195873c8b8250c956fd2bae582dacb883368dd02944e975:0
  • value  113415
    address  3Lpk29PHNjBqiHA2ssBrRmbm37diy57idJ
  • 723e40bb9d5f366ee195873c8b8250c956fd2bae582dacb883368dd02944e975:1
  • value  62582616
    address  18Kh7rEUnQ4kd63WoaBZnQSdAYikzeAFxj